About agriculture in Puerto de Aguirre
Puerto de Aguirre is situated in the northern part of the Querétaro municipality, within the scenic Bajío region of central Mexico. The surrounding landscape features a mix of rolling hills and fertile plains, characteristic of the state's high plateau. The area is marked by a temperate climate that transitions into semi-arid zones, creating a diverse environment for various rural and agricultural activities.
The region is a hub for diverse agricultural production, with large fields dedicated to staples like maize, sorghum, and alfalfa. In recent years, there has been a significant increase in intensive greenhouse farming, particularly for high-value vegetables like tomatoes and bell peppers. Additionally, the area supports a robust livestock sector, including cattle ranching and modern poultry facilities that contribute significantly to the local economy.
For agronomists and seasonal workers, Puerto de Aguirre offers opportunities in both traditional field crops and high-tech protected agriculture. Employment often peaks during the sowing and harvesting seasons for grain crops, while greenhouse operations provide more consistent, year-round roles. Professionals can expect a work environment that blends traditional Mexican farming practices with modern technological advancements in irrigation and crop management.
